Company: OMG Partners
Penalty: $140,000
Year: 2024
Date: July 12, 2024
Offense Group: environment-related offenses
Primary Offense: oil spill
Violation Description: OMG Partners of Turlock, Calif. agreed to pay $140,000 to resolve claims of Clean Water Act violations after one of the company's tanker trucks overturned and a fuel product spilled into the roadway, Laguna Creek, Coyote Creek, and the Don Edwards National Wildlife Refuge. The fuel reached the San Francisco Bay.
Level of Government: federal
Action Type: agency action
Agency: Environmental Protection Agency referral to the Justice Department
Civil or Criminal Case: civil
Facility State: California
